10 New Country Music Albums Worth Checking Out

This year country music lovers have seen the release of quite a number of music albums. What’s your pick of the best country music albums release so far this year?

Sure, I have my own list, which I’ll share someday. But for now let’s hear what’s on a real professional’s list.

Craig Shelburne of Country Music Television (CMT) recently wrote an article listing his list for the year thus far. Here is a short quote from the article:

We’re about halfway through the year, so before I dive into another pile of new CDs, I’m moving a big ol’ stack to the file cabinet — except for these 10 albums released earlier this year, which I’d recommend to music fans with an adventurous ear. I have noted one of my favorite tracks from each selection, in case you want to download some tunes.

And finally, here is Craig Shelburne’s list of the 10 new country music albums worth checking out (album title in bold, and label in bracket):

  1. Matthew Barber, Ghost Notes (Outside Music)
  2. Hayes Carll, Trouble in Mind (Lost Highway)
  3. Kathleen Edwards, Asking For Flowers (Rounder)
  4. Griffin House, Flying Upside Down (Nettwerk)
  5. Lady Antebellum, Lady Antebellum (Capitol Nashville)
  6. Shelby Lynne, Just a Little Lovin’ (Lost Highway)
  7. Kathy Mattea, Coal (Captain Potato)
  8. Tift Merritt, Another Country (Fantasy)
  9. Justin Rutledge, Man Descending (Six Shooter)
  10. The Weepies, Hideaway (Nettwerk)
